Acorn 130 Outdoor Stairlift

The Acorn 130 Outdoor is the outdoor version of Acorn's straight stairlift, fitted to external steps where getting to the front door, the garden or the driveway has become the hard part of the day.

Quick answer: it is a weatherproofed straight stairlift for outside steps, supplied with a protective cover, battery-powered so it works in a power cut. It costs more than the indoor equivalent, and the survey has to look at ground fixings, drainage and a safe outdoor power supply.

Typical uses

  • Steps from the pavement or driveway up to a front door.
  • Back-door steps down to a garden or patio.
  • Terraced or sloping gardens with a straight run of steps.
  • Access to a garage or an outbuilding.

If the outdoor steps turn a corner, the survey will look at a curved solution rather than this model — see the Acorn 180.

Built for outside

  • Weather-resistant construction for UK rain, damp and cold.
  • Protective cover for the seat and carriage between journeys.
  • Folding seat, arms and footrest so the steps stay usable.
  • Battery drive with charging points, so a power cut is not a problem.
  • Safety sensors and seatbelt as standard, the same as indoors.

What the surveyor checks

  1. The run and rise of the steps, and whether they are genuinely straight.
  2. What the rail can be fixed to — concrete, stone or a suitable base.
  3. Drainage and standing water at the bottom of the run.
  4. Where a safe, correctly installed outdoor power supply can be provided.
  5. Whether the parked lift blocks a path, gate or escape route.

What affects the price

  • Rail length and the number of steps.
  • Any groundworks or base needed for fixings.
  • Bringing power out to the lift.
  • Access for the installation team.
  • Whether you qualify for VAT relief.

Looking after an outdoor lift

Outdoor lifts work harder than indoor ones. Use the cover, keep the rail clear of leaves and ice, and keep the lift on a regular service plan — see our stairlift servicing guide.
